Outline of Final Research Achievements

The purpose of this study was to develop a program for supporting the transfer movement from wheelchair to the car in individuals with tetraplegia, and to analysis in particular, focuses on the movement of their trunk.
As the result, the transfer movement to the car in individuals with tetraplegia, same as transfer movement to the bed, it was found that their trunk forward inclination assisted in their higher buttocks lift off. Furthermore, by increasing their hip flexion angle, they reduce the risk of falling, it has been considered that is performed efficiently car transfer movement.
